Israel Matzav: Hmmm....Lebanese security forces discovered an Israeli internet server hidden in a small town in Lebanon's Chouf District, the Hezbollah-owned al-Manar network reported Saturday.
The report said the server was wired to antennae aimed in the direction of Israel, and that all of the equipment was confiscated.
The Lebanese OTV network, owned by politician Michel Aoun, reported that the army had broken into a structure in Jabal al-Baruch in April and found equipment suspected of serving Israeli intelligence.
The report said the army had intervened after receiving intelligence regarding an "illegal internet company" operating within its borders.Read All at :
